Transaction 7f61bbd596886e46733e18d98e52fc17c2345f711302f4f7b4df3218ff97643d
1 Input
1 Output
-
7f61bbd596886e46733e18d98e52fc17c2345f711302f4f7b4df3218ff97643d:0
- value
- 309027
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 092c81d52316ae24f3ae825117346cadb9b2595fecdf55bf80695d9081baf7ad
- address
- bc1ppykgr4frz6hzfuawsfg3wdrv4kumyk2lan04t0uqd9wepqd677kswuru92